Rohingya boat capsize a tragic and needless loss of life

12 February 2020
The tragedy that unfolded on Tuesday is as disturbing as it was preventable. The local authorities, as well as UN agencies and other international organisations, are perfectly aware of a transnational human trafficking network that preys on vulnerable refugees and often traps them into a life of bonded labour and slavery. Despite this, very little has been done to dismantle this network.
